广发证券一面
一面-2023年7月20日
- 自我介绍
- 围绕项目问了一圈。不太难,没深挖。
- C++(压力
- C++11中智能指针的分类。是线程安全的嘛,如果不是使用时怎么处理。
- C++11中线程安全提供的mutex等。11中的移动语义。声明一个类,将其一个对象move到另一个指针,可以吗,发生了什么。
- C++中基类的析构函数能否调用虚函数。
- 构建一个宏函数,提供结构体类型和成员变量名称,计算该变量在结构体中的偏移量。
- Linux中socket编程时,有一个复用的API,setaddr啥。阻塞和非阻塞编程。
- Linux IO多路复用。select、poll、epoll等。
- fork使用,父进程中一个指针指向一个地址,子进程中该指针是同样的地址,指向同样的空间吗。